Interactive technologies are increasingly becoming part of modern educational environments. Schools and kindergartens are looking for tools that not only engage children but also support learning objectives, creativity, and cognitive development. iSandBox UTS is widely known for its educational applications in geography and natural sciences, but one of its most versatile modes for education is Artist Mode.

Artist Mode transforms the interactive sandbox into a creative learning space where children explore color, form, and volume through hands-on interaction with sand.

What Is Artist Mode in iSandBox

Artist Mode is a visual and artistic mode in which the sandbox surface is dynamically colored based on height and shape. As children shape the sand, bright contrasting colors appear in real time, turning the sandbox into a living canvas.

Instead of drawing with pencils or brushes, children create images with their hands, experimenting with relief, lines, and shapes. There are no predefined tasks or correct results — the process itself becomes the core educational value.

Educational Benefits of Artist Mode

Developing Creativity and Imagination

Artist Mode encourages free artistic expression. Children invent patterns, abstract compositions, landscapes, and imaginary worlds. This supports:

  • creative thinking

  • imagination and self-expression

  • confidence in experimenting without fear of mistakes

For early childhood education, this type of open-ended creativity is especially important.

Sensory and Motor Skill Development

Working with sand engages tactile perception and fine motor skills. These sensory experiences directly contribute to:

  • hand-eye coordination

  • development of neural connections

  • preparation for writing and drawing skills

Unlike digital screens, Artist Mode preserves physical interaction with real materials.

Understanding Space, Shape, and Volume

Although Artist Mode is artistic, it naturally introduces children to:

  • concepts of height and depth

  • spatial relationships

  • cause-and-effect thinking

Children see how changing the shape of the sand instantly affects colors and visual structure, forming a foundation for later studies in mathematics and geometry.

Supporting Speech and Communication Skills

Artist Mode often becomes a storytelling tool. Children explain what they created, describe shapes, colors, and ideas, and discuss their work with peers and teachers. This supports:

  • speech development

  • vocabulary expansion

  • social interaction and collaboration

It is also effective in inclusive educational settings.

Artist Mode in Kindergartens

In kindergartens, Artist Mode is most commonly used for:

  • creative development activities

  • free play with educational value

  • individual or small-group sessions

  • relaxation and emotional regulation

The mode is intuitive and requires no complex instructions, making it suitable even for younger children.

Using Artist Mode in Schools

In primary schools, Artist Mode can be integrated into:

  • art and creative lessons

  • extracurricular activities and clubs

  • project-based learning

  • emotional and sensory breaks during the school day

It complements traditional teaching methods without replacing hands-on creativity.

Why Educators Choose Artist Mode

For teachers and educators, Artist Mode offers:

  • easy integration into existing lessons

  • flexible use without strict сценарии

  • suitability for different ages and abilities

  • support for both group and individual work

The teacher’s role shifts from instructor to facilitator, encouraging exploration and discussion.
